html
{
  height: 100%; margin-bottom: 1px;
}
body
{
  background: #cdb79e url(images/papyrus.jpg);
  color: #2C1414;
  margin: 4% auto;
  padding: 0px;
  font-family: "lucinda calligraphy", serif;
  line-height: 110%;
  font-size: 100%
  text-align: center;
}
.wrapper
{
  background: #ffeedd url(images/grbg.jpg) repeat-x;
  width: 760px;
  margin: auto;
  border:  1px solid #2C1414;
  padding: 2px;
}
.header
{
  background: #572919 url(images/header.jpg) no-repeat left top;
  color: #eeccaa;
  text-align: left;
  font-family: "lucinda calligraphy";
  font-style: italic;
  font-weight: bold;
  font-size: 130%;
  margin: 0px;
  padding: 0px 15px 0px 300px;
  width: 100%;
  height: 100px;
  border-top: 1px solid #2C1414;
  border-right: 1px solid #2C1414;
  border-left: 1px solid #2C1414;
  border-bottom: 1px solid #2C1414;
}
a
{
  text-decoration: none;
  background: none;
  color: #2C1414;
}
a:visisted
{
  text-decoration: none;
  background: none;
  color: #2C1414;
}
a:hover
{
  text-decoration: none;
  background: none;
  color: #2C1414;
}
.nav
{
  background: #ffeedd url(images/grbg.jpg) repeat-x;
  color: #2C1414;
  width: 20%;
  text-align: center;
  font-weight: bold;
  padding: 12px 10px 12px 10px;
  vertical-align: top;
  border: 1px solid #2C1414;
}
.nav p
{
  background: #eeccaa;
  color: #2C1414;
  border: 1px solid #2C1414;
  padding: 2px 3px 2px 0px;
  margin: 8px 0px 0px 0px;
}
.nav a 
{
  font-size: 85%;
  text-decoration: none;
  background: #eeccaa;
  color: #2C1414;
}
.nav a:visited
{
  font-size: 85%;
  text-decoration: none;
  background: #eeccaa;
  color: #2C1414;
}
.nav a:hover 
{
  font-size: 85%;
  text-decoration: underline;
  background:#eeccaa;
  color: #2C1414;
}
.active
{
  background: #eeccaa;
  color: #800000;
  font-size: 85%;
}
.nav img
{
  margin: 0px 0px 0px 3px;
}
.content
{
  background: #ffeedd;
  color: #2C1414;
  text-align: center;
  width: 80%;
  vertical-align: top;
  border: 1px solid #2C1414;
  margin: 0px;
  padding: 12px 20px 3px 10px;
}
.content p
{
  text-align: left;
  font-size: 85%;
  padding: 0px 10px;
}
.content1
{
  background: #ffeedd;
  color: #2C1414;
  font-size: 85%;
  text-align: left;
  width: 80%;
  vertical-align: top;
  border: 1px solid #2C1414;
  margin: 0px;
  padding: 10px 20px 0px 10px;
}
.content2
{
  background: #ffeedd;
  color: #2C1414;
  font-weight: bold;
  text-align: center;
  vertical-align: top;
  width: 80%;
  border: 1px solid #2C1414;
  margin: 0px;
  padding: 25px 20px 15px 10px;
}
content3
{
  background: #ffeedd;
  color: #2C1414;
  font-family: "lucinda calligraphy";
  font-weight: bold;
  text-align: center;
  vertical-align: top;
  width: 80%;
  border: 1px solid #2C1414;
  margin: 0px;
  padding: 20px 15px 0px 15px;
}
.content3 img
{
  margin: 15px 15px 20px 15px;
}
.content4
{
  background: #ffeedd;
  color: #2C1414;
  font-size: 100%;
  text-align: left;
  width: 80%;
  vertical-align: top;
  border: 1px solid #2C1414;
  margin: 0px;
  padding: 0px 5px 0px 25px;
}
.content5
{
  background: #ffeedd;
  color: #2C1414;
  font-size: 100%;
  text-align: center;
  width: 80%;
  vertical-align: top;
  border: 1px solid #2C1414;
  margin: 0px;
  padding: 20px 20px 0px 20px;
}
.content4 img
{
  margin: 45px 15px 32px 10px;
}
h1
{
  font-family: "lucinda calligraphy";
  font-size: 200%;
  font-style: italic;
  color: #eeccaa;
  text-align: center;
  margin: 0px;
  padding: 20px 0px 10px 30px;
}
h2
{
  font-family: "lucinda calligraphy";
  font-size: 175%;
  text-align: center;
  margin: 0px;
  padding: 0px 0px 10px 0px;
}
h3
{
  font-family: "lucinda calligraphy";
  font-size: 130%;
  text-align: center;
  margin: 0px;
  padding: 0px 0px 0px 0px;
}
h4
{
  font-family: "lucinda calligraphy";
  font-size: 110%;
  text-align: center;
  margin: 0px;
  padding: 35px 0px 10px 0px;
}

hr
{
  width: 90%;
  height: 1px;
  color: #2C1414;
}
.tn
{
  width: 40%;
  text-align: right;
}
.tnc
{
  width: 40%;
  text-align: right;
  padding: 0px 25px 0px 0px;
}
.disc
{
  text-align: center;
  padding: 0px 30px 0px 0px;
  font-size: 85%;
}
.lgimg
{
  padding: 20px 10px 20px 20px;
}
.wdimg
{
  padding: 5px 5px 20px 0px;
}
.small
{
  text-align: center;
}
.small a
{
  font-size: small;
  text-decoration: underline;
  font-weight: bold;
  background: none;
  color: #2C1414;
}
.small a:visited
{
  font-size: small;
  text-decoration: underline;
  font-weight: bold;
  background: none;
  color: #2C1414;
}
.small a:hover 
{
  font-size: small;
  text-decoration: underline;
  font-weight: bold;
  background: none;
  color: #800000;
}
.small2 a
{
  font-size: small;
  text-decoration: none;
  font-weight: bold;
  background: none;
  color: #2C1414;
}
.small2 a:visited
{
  font-size: small;
  text-decoration: none;
  font-weight: bold;
  background: none;
  color: #2C1414;
}
.small2 a:hover 
{
  font-size: small;
  text-decoration: underline;
  font-weight: bold;
  background: none;
  color: #800000;
}
.active2
{
  background: none;
  color: #800000;
  font-size: small;
}
.copy
{
  text-align: center;
  font-size: small;
  padding: 5px 0px;
}
.ipg
{
  text-align: left;
  font-size: 100%;
  font-weight: bold;
  padding: 0px 10px 15px 10px;
}
.ipt
{
  text-align: left;
  font-size: 100%;
  font-weight: bold;
  padding: 0px 10px 0px 10px;
  margin: 0px 0px 0px 0px;
}
.ipq
{
  text-align: center;
  font-size: 100%;
  padding: 0px 10px 0px 10px;
  margin: 0px;
}
.tp
{ 
   width: 10em; 
   height: 2em;
   text-align: center;
   padding: 0px 0px 0px 4px;
   border: 1px solid #2C1414;  
}
img a
{
  border: 0;
}

  